How much does an Efo Financial Manager, Tax make?

As of March 2025, the average annual salary for a Manager, Tax at Efo Financial is $112,592, which translates to approximately $54 per hour. Salaries for Manager, Tax at Efo Financial typically range from $98,950 to $127,301, reflecting the diverse roles within the company.

EFO Financial Group is a provider of alternative financing solutions to U.S.-based companies seeking capital in challenging and dynamic markets. The firm makes direct private loans across several asset classes ranging from $2 million to more than $50 million, allowing companies to continue operating through periods of insufficient liquidity. By leveraging its speed, certainty and experience, EFO is able to successfully execute transactions and help ensure the full potential of the underlying investment.

  5. Tax Preparation: Tax preparation is the process of preparing tax returns, often income tax returns, often for a person other than the taxpayer, and generally for compensation. Tax preparation may be done by the taxpayer with or without the help of tax preparation software and online services. Tax preparation may also be done by a licensed professional such as an attorney, certified public accountant or enrolled agent, or by an unlicensed tax preparation business. Because United States income tax laws are considered to be complicated, many taxpayers seek outside assistance with taxes (59.2% of individual tax returns in 2007 were filed by paid preparers). The remainder of this article describes tax preparation by someone other than the taxpayer. Some states have licensing requirements for anyone who prepares tax returns for a fee and some for fee-based preparation of state tax returns only. The Free File Alliance provides free tax preparation software for individuals with less than $58,000 of adjusted gross income for tax year 2010. People who make more than $58,000 can use Free File Fillable Forms, electronic versions of U.S. Internal Revenue Service (IRS) paper forms.
